Understanding Power Switch Buttons


Power switch buttons are essential components in any electrical system, allowing users to control the flow of electricity to various devices. Understanding these devices is crucial for anyone looking to make informed decisions when purchasing one. In essence, a power switch button acts as a bridge between the electrical supply and the device, enabling or disabling its operation.

The Importance of Power Switches in Daily Life


Power switches are ubiquitous in our daily lives. From turning on lights in our homes to powering up appliances, these devices play a vital role in our comfort and convenience. It's essential to understand their functionalities, types, and safety features to make the right choice for your specific needs.

Types of Power Switch Buttons: An Overview


When it comes to power switch buttons, there are several types available, each serving different purposes. Understanding these variations can help you make a more informed purchase.

1. Toggle Switches


Toggle switches are the most common type of power switch. They operate by flipping a lever up or down to either turn the power on or off. These switches are straightforward to use and are often found in residential settings.

2. Push Button Switches


Push button switches are typically used in applications where a momentary action is required. Pressing the button completes the circuit, allowing electricity to flow, and releasing the button cuts the power. These are often used in applications such as doorbells or emergency stop buttons.

3. Rocker Switches


Rocker switches are another popular option, featuring a design that rocks back and forth. This type allows users to turn on or off with a simple push on one side or the other. They're commonly found in light switches.

4. Dimmer Switches


Dimmer switches are specialized devices that allow for the adjustment of lighting levels. They provide versatility in lighting design, making them an excellent choice for creating the right ambiance in a room.

5. Smart Switches


With the advent of smart technology, smart switches have become increasingly popular. These devices can be controlled remotely via a smartphone app, allowing users to manage their lighting and appliances from anywhere.

Key Features to Consider When Buying


Choosing the right power switch button involves more than just picking a style; several key features should be considered to ensure optimal performance and safety.

1. Electrical Ratings


Always check the electrical ratings of a switch, which indicate the maximum voltage and current it can handle. This is critical to ensure that the switch is suitable for your intended application.

2. Material and Durability


The material of the switch affects its lifespan and performance. Look for options made from high-quality materials, such as polycarbonate or metal, which can withstand wear and tear over time.

3. Compatibility with Existing Wiring


Make sure that the switch you choose is compatible with your existing wiring system. This ensures ease of installation and prevents electrical issues.

4. Aesthetics and Design


Consider the aesthetics of the switch, especially if it will be prominently displayed. Many switches come in various colors and designs, enabling you to choose one that fits your décor.

5. Safety Ratings


Look for switches that have been tested and certified by recognized safety standards organizations. This ensures that the product meets essential safety requirements.

How to Choose the Right Power Switch Button for Your Needs


Selecting the right power switch involves a systematic approach to assess your unique requirements.

1. Assess Your Electrical Needs


Evaluate the devices you intend to control with the switch. Consider the voltage and current requirements and ensure the switch can handle them.

2. Consider the Environment


Think about where the switch will be installed. Outdoor or damp environments may require switches that are weatherproof or rated for moisture resistance.

3. Determine User Accessibility


Ensure that the switch is easy to operate for everyone who will use it. Consider the height of the switch, especially in homes with children or individuals with mobility issues.

4. Future-Proofing


If you plan to upgrade your electrical systems in the future, consider purchasing a switch that can accommodate higher ratings or additional features.

Installation Tips for Your Power Switch Button


Installing a power switch button can be a straightforward task, especially with the right guidance.

1. Turn Off the Power


Before installation, always turn off the power supply to avoid any electrical hazards. This step is critical for your safety.

2. Use Proper Tools


Gather all necessary tools, including screwdrivers, wire strippers, and a voltage tester, to ensure a smooth installation process.

3. Follow Manufacturer Instructions


Carefully follow the manufacturer’s instructions for installation. Each switch may have specific steps that should be adhered to for optimal performance.

4. Test the Installation


After installation, turn the power back on and test the switch to ensure it operates correctly. This step is crucial to confirm that everything works as it should.

Safety Considerations When Using Power Switches


Safety should always be a priority when dealing with electrical components. Here are some essential safety considerations:

1. Regular Inspection


Periodically check your switches for signs of wear, damage, or corrosion. Address any issues immediately to prevent electrical fires or malfunctions.

2. Avoid Overloading Circuits


Ensure that you do not overload the circuit connected to your switch. Overloading can lead to overheating and potential hazards.

3. Use GFCI Switches in Wet Areas


In areas prone to moisture, such as kitchens and bathrooms, use Ground Fault Circuit Interrupter (GFCI) switches to enhance safety.

Common Issues and Troubleshooting


Even with careful selection and installation, issues may arise. Here's how to troubleshoot some common problems:

1. Switch Not Working


If the switch fails to operate, check the power supply and connections. Ensure that the switch is correctly wired and that there are no blown fuses.

2. Flickering Lights


Flickering lights may indicate a loose connection or a faulty switch. Inspect the wiring and connections to resolve this issue.

3. Overheating Switch


If your switch becomes excessively hot, it may be due to overloading or a poor connection. Turn off the power and inspect the wiring for any issues.

Frequently Asked Questions (FAQs)


1. What is the average lifespan of a power switch button?


Power switches can last several years, with many rated for over 10,000 operations. Regular maintenance can extend their lifespan.

2. Can I replace a standard switch with a smart switch?


Yes, but ensure that your wiring is compatible. You may need a neutral wire for many smart switches.

3. Why is my switch making a buzzing noise?


A buzzing switch may indicate a loose connection or a problem with the electrical circuit. It's advisable to have a qualified electrician check it.

4. How do I know if a switch is suitable for outdoor use?


Look for switches specifically labeled as weatherproof or suitable for outdoor installations. They should have appropriate IP ratings.

5. What should I do if I experience frequent tripping of my circuit breaker?


Frequent tripping may indicate an overloaded circuit or a short circuit. Consult an electrician to diagnose and resolve the issue safely.
